Southeast Gulf of Mexico .SYNOPSIS...Potential Tropical Cyclone One near 25.6N 83.1W 1002 mb at 5 AM EDT moving NE at 16 kt. Maximum sustained winds 35 kt gusts 45 kt, occurring across the southeastern semicircle. One will move NE reach the SW coast of Florida shortly after sunrise, then reach near 27.1N 80.9W Sat afternoon, then continue NE and exit into the Atlc waters Sat evening then accelerate NE through Mon. Weak high pressure will dominate the Gulf through mid week. ...TROPICAL STORM WARNING... .TODAY...TROPICAL STORM CONDITIONS EXPECTED. NW to N winds 30 to 35 kt. Seas 3 to 8 ft. .TONIGHT...NW to N winds 10 to 15 kt. Seas 3 to 5 ft. .SUN...NW winds 5 to 10 kt. Seas 3 to 4 ft. .SUN NIGHT...NW to N winds 5 to 10 kt, shifting to SE to S after midnight. Seas 3 ft in the evening, subsiding to 2 ft or less. .MON...E to SE winds 5 to 10 kt. Seas 2 ft or less. .MON NIGHT...E to SE winds 5 to 10 kt. Seas 2 ft or less. .TUE...E to SE winds 5 to 10 kt. Seas 2 ft or less. .TUE NIGHT...E to SE winds 10 to 15 kt. Seas 2 ft or less. .WED...E to SE winds 5 to 10 kt. Seas 2 ft or less. Within 200 nm east of the coast of Florida .SYNOPSIS...Potential Tropical Cyclone One across the SE Gulf of Mexico near 25.6N 83.1W 1002 mb at 5 AM EDT moving NE at 16 kt. Maximum sustained winds 35 kt gusts 45 kt. One will continue NE and move across southern Florida, reaching near 27.1N 80.9W this afternoon Sat morning as a Tropical Storm near 25.8N 82.0W, move NE , then accelerate NE and reach 30.7N 74.6W Sun afternoon, then move N of 31N Sun night. High pressure will build westward into the Bahamas Tue then weaken through Wed. ...TROPICAL STORM WARNING... .TODAY...TROPICAL STORM CONDITIONS EXPECTED. S to SW winds 30 to 35 kt S of 27N, and SE 30 to 35 kt N of 27N. Seas 3 to 10 ft in SE to S swell. Scattered showers and isolated tstms. .TONIGHT...TROPICAL STORM CONDITIONS EXPECTED. SW winds 30 to 35 kt S of 27N, and S 30 to 40 kt N of 27N. Seas 3 to 12 ft in SE to S swell. Scattered showers and isolated tstms. .SUN...TROPICAL STORM CONDITIONS POSSIBLE. S of 27N,SW to W winds 20 to 25 kt. N of 27N,W to NW winds 25 to 30 kt, diminishing to 15 to 20 kt in the afternoon. Seas 3 to 11 ft in S swell. Scattered showers and isolated tstms. .SUN NIGHT...SW to W winds 15 to 20 kt. Seas 3 to 7 ft. Scattered showers and isolated tstms. .MON...W to NW winds 10 to 15 kt, shifting to S 5 to 10 kt in the afternoon. Seas 3 to 5 ft. .MON NIGHT...SE to S winds 5 to 10 kt. Seas 3 to 5 ft. .TUE...SE to S winds 5 to 10 kt. Seas 3 to 5 ft. .TUE NIGHT...E to SE winds 5 to 10 kt. Seas 3 to 5 ft. .WED...NE to E winds 5 to 10 kt. Seas 3 to 5 ft.
